If you want to start your pasturing, this animal is very easy to raise and it quickly reproduce. This is because it gains so much weight by feeding less food. The main reason they are not costly to raise because the owners no longer have to buy now and then for its food and give so much water everyday.

Rabbits have rapid reproduction rate. Thus, this make farmers happy because they can now sell a lot of it in the market. It was said that one farmer can have a dozen in a single year by having only one doe. By still keeping a low feed consumption, the animals being raised are doubled.

Farmers will always say that this is the healthiest ones in the market. It is known to have low unsaturated and saturated fat levels and the best substitute to pig meats that have high levels of fat which can further lead to acquiring serious cases of bodily diseases if always eaten.

It has high levels of Vitamin B 12 which is helpful to relieve mouth and tongue soreness that eventually pushes a person to have a good appetite. Aside from Vitamin B, it is also a source of selenium and protein which can lower the percentage of prostate cancer growth. Other that the thing mentioned, the meat has a bone ratio which is higher than chicken.

This animal tastes the same as chicken. The meat is white which can be digested easily and with relatively disease free. This can even replace chicken in your home recipes. You can even make your own rabbit meat stew and ragu or any other recipe that you can think of.

On the other hand, farming rabbits is not as easy as raising other animals. They are natural ground diggers so there is no reason for you to just cage them. If they are caged, most likely, they will get diseases, parasites, and heat sickness.
